There's a rectangle. The width is 6p + 4 and the length is 2p + 1. Simplify your expression.

You do not say but I suspect you want the area.
Area = (6 p + 4)(2 p + 1)
= 12 p^2 + 6 p + 8 p + 4
= 12 p^2 + 14 p + 4
